Humanistic approach to psychology was founded by ___________?

Correct answer: B. Rogers and Maslow

  • A. Wundt and James
  • B. Rogers and Maslow
  • C. Watson and Skinner
  • D. Freud and Jung

Explanation

Carl Rogers and Abraham Maslow established the humanistic approach, which emphasizes free will, personal growth, and self-actualization. Watson and Skinner represented behaviorism, while Freud and Jung represented psychoanalytic traditions.
